In theory it can go wherever a Northern 153 can go although it normally runs coupled to another unit due to it not having a wheelchair ramp fitted (I can't remember the exact circumstances behind its missing ramp though).

yesterday (sun 11th) i travelled on the 09:54 from Leeds - Manchester Victoria, this service was formed of 155341, 153366, 153360.

155341 was leading out of Leeds, then 153360 leading after changing ends at Bradford. on arrival at Manchester Victoria 155341 detatched and formed the 1208 service back to Leeds, 153366 & 153360 then formed the 13:40 ECS to Newton Heath. It even advertised on the departure boards:

Plat 3, 13:40 ECS to Newton Heath T.M.D.
Calling at: Newton Heath T.M.D only.

Its a good job the 09:54 service from Leeds was 4 cars as by the time it got to Hebden Bridge all seats taken and standing room only from Todmorden all way into Manchester.

I caught the 14:08 back to Leeds which was formed of 158901 which was pretty cosy but no one standing, althought in our carriage 52901 the lights kept tripping into emergency lighting and the conductor having to reset them all the time.
